OMG Updates UML Standard, Issues New Healthcare Specification at California MeetingNEEDHAM, Mass. --(Business Wire)-- The Object Management Group (OMG®) held its quarterly technical meeting at the Hyatt Regency in Burlingame, CA (News - Alert) from December 10th-14th. The meeting was sponsored by: No Magic, Inc, Sparx Systems and Modeliosoft. During the week, OMG members elected six new members to the Architecture Board. Elisa (News - Alert) Kendall of Thematix Partners and Sridhar Iyengar of IBM were both elected to two-year Domain TC seats while J.D. Baker of Sparx Systems was chosen to complete the balance on a Domain TC seat. Tom Rutt of Fujitsu (News - Alert), Pete Rivett of Adaptive, and Matthew Hause of Atego were all elected to two-year Platform TC seats. OMG is an international, open membership, not-for-profit computer industry standards consortium. OMG Task Forces develop enterprise integration standards for a wide range of technologies and an even wider range of industries. OMG's modeling standards enable powerful visual design, execution and maintenance of software and other processes.
